Transaction 089664c09d4e424bef8d2bedf77a2169398e99b8c191d077ec16423357d50183
1 Input
1 Output
-
089664c09d4e424bef8d2bedf77a2169398e99b8c191d077ec16423357d50183:0
- value
- 5945509
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d7d66f505d8b7c30f87da5ad76ba041a170977cd OP_EQUAL
- address
- MTaQPsCEQ7BaXcQnDoAvYH2TBhB9DQ5u7G